HSUX is a free Chrome extension developed by Ville Korhonen. It falls under the category of Browsers and is specifically classified as an Add-ons & Tools subcategory.
This extension is designed to remove annoying full-page ads from the HS.fi website, but only if you are logged in. It targets the full-page ads that require user intervention, forcing users to click "close ad" before being able to view the page content, even if they are already paying for the service.
HSUX works by injecting JavaScript into the page and hiding the ad if it is present. It achieves this by removing the "frontpage-ad-visible" class from the body tag if the "user-logged-in" class is also present.
The extension has undergone several updates, including versionwhich added the ability to remove ads asking users to order the newspaper, and now loads even when using HTTPS. Versionintroduced console logging when removing elements, while versionadded Google Analytics tracking to count how many times ads have been hidden and collect anonymous data. Versionfixed the GA protocol handling.
Overall, HSUX is a useful Chrome extension for HS.fi users who want to remove full-page ads and have a smoother browsing experience.
